The History of the Gimlet
The Gimlet has a fascinating history, dating back to the 19th century. Originally, it was conceived as a health drink. Yes, you heard that right! British sailors used to drink it to prevent scurvy, a disease caused by vitamin C deficiency. The lime juice in the Gimlet was a handy source of this crucial vitamin.
Over the years, its medicinal purpose evolved into a more pleasurable one, with the Gimlet becoming a much-loved cocktail. The name “Gimlet” is thought to be named after a hand tool used to tap barrels on the high seas, a nod to its nautical beginnings.

The Classic Gimlet
A classic Gimlet is made with just three ingredients: gin, fresh lime juice, and simple syrup. The magic happens when these three elements come together in a perfect harmony of flavors.
While some cocktail aficionados may argue about the precise ratios, a generally accepted formula is two parts gin to one part each of lime juice and simple syrup. This ratio allows all the components to shine without overpowering one another.
Ingredients
- 60 ml Gin
- 30 ml Fresh lime juice
- 30 ml Simple syrup
- Ice cubes
- Lime wheel, for garnish
Instructions
- In a cocktail shaker, combine the gin, fresh lime juice, and simple syrup.
- Fill the shaker with ice, cover, and shake well until the outside of the shaker becomes frosty.
- Strain the cocktail into a chilled coupe or martini glass.
- Garnish with the lime wheel. Serve and enjoy!

Tips for Gimlet
Always use fresh lime juice for a more vibrant flavor. Experiment with your gin; each one will give a different flavor profile. Try sweetening your cocktail with a flavored simple syrup for a unique twist.
